Subject: Handover — StockPilot release duties

Hi Verena,

As discussed, I'm transferring release responsibility for StockPilot, our vending-machine restock planner, effective Monday. The pipeline runs on the Copperline build cluster; every artifact is signed before promotion to the depot channel. I've documented the rotation schedule and revocation procedure in the runbook, and the previous key was retired last quarter with no outstanding artifacts. For your audit records, the current deploy key is included below.

signing key of bagap-yawep = bky13_TbfT6ZMUoGJo2

**Q: Why are my release smoke tests getting 429s from Gatewick?**

Short version: the internal gateway rate-limits per service token, and release smoke tests share a token with staging traffic. If you're seeing throttling during a cut, request a temporary limit bump rather than retry-spamming. Bumps take effect in about a minute. The limit tiers and bump request form are here.

operations page: https://jenkins.zemvarcloud.local/job/merge_requests/repo/build/73930b4b30f0a8ed

## 4.2.0 — Changed Defaults

The Thornvale query planner regression reported after 4.1.3 is fixed. Root cause: the planner's cost model defaulted to the new index-scan heuristic, which mis-priced wide joins and produced the slow ticket queries support flagged. The heuristic is now off by default; customers who opted in explicitly keep their setting. Expect affected tenants' report queries to return to pre-4.1.3 timings without action on their part. If a customer asks what changed, the planner now ships with these default configuration values.

settings of yaguf-bahip:
druwyn:
  log_level: debug
  metrics_host: metrics.druwyn.qorvelsys.internal
  pool_size: 32

Finance Review Summary — Larkspur Loyalty Overhaul

Quick recap for the team: the revamped Larkspur Points scheme came in under budget, though redemption liability is creeping up faster than modelled — about 8% over forecast. Breakage assumptions need a rework before year-end close. Marketing wants the premium tier live by spring, which tightens our accrual timeline. The rationale from leadership is noted confidentially below.

confidential, kagap-kajeg: Istethax Holdings is in early talks to buy Ulaielix Works for about $23.7 million. The Lamys launch date is July 6, and nothing goes to the press before then.